基于输出层函数为线性函数的三层前馈神经网络,结合自适应步长和动量解耦的伪牛顿算法及 迭代最小二乘法导出了一种混合算法.仿真证明该混合算法自适应能力强、计算量小、收敛速度快,是一 种有效的工程实用算法。
Based on the three-layer feedforward neural network whose output layer function is a linear function, a hybrid algorithm is derived by combining pseudo-Newton algorithm with adaptive step and momentum decoupling and iterative least square method. Simulation shows that the hybrid algorithm has strong adaptability, low computational complexity and fast convergence speed. It is an effective engineering practical algorithm.
